.site-title a,.site-description{color: #333D46;}
#nav-topbar .nav-toggle{color: #333D46;}
.toggle-search{position:absolute;right:0;top:-50px;}
.search-expand{position:absolute;top:0;right:0;}
#nav-header .container{padding:0;}
.fixed{padding:0;}
.fixed .toggle-search,
.fixed .search-expand{right:0;}
/*color 1*/
@media only screen and (min-width:720px){
    #nav-topbar .nav > li > a{color: #666;}
    #nav-topbar .nav ul{background:#333D46 url(../img/opacity-10.png) repeat;}
    #nav-header .nav > li > a{padding:15px;color: #fff;}
    #nav-header .nav li.current_page_item > a,
    #nav-header .nav li.current-menu-item > a,
    #nav-header .nav li.current-menu-ancestor > a,
    #nav-header .nav li.current-post-ancestor > a,
    #nav-header .nav li.current-post-parent > a{color:#fff;background-color:#35AADC;}
}
#nav-topbar.nav-container{background:#fff;border-bottom: 1px #ddd solid;}
#nav-topbar .nav{margin-bottom: -2px;}
.side-buttons .side-buttons-box > a:hover{background:#35AADC;}
.side-buttons .current-bg{background:#35AADC;}
/*color 2*/
::selection{background:#35AADC;}
::-moz-selection{background:#35AADC;}
a{color:#35AADC;}
.themeform input[type="submit"],
.themeform button[type="submit"]{background:#35AADC;}
.side-right .sidebar-toggle{background:#35AADC;}
.resp-tab-active{background-color:#35AADC;}
.resp-tab-content{border-top:2px solid #35AADC;}
.resp-easy-accordion h2.resp-accordion{background:#35AADC;}
@media only screen and (max-width:719px){
    h2.resp-accordion{background:#35AADC;}
}
#header{background:#f4f4f4;}
.btn:hover{background-color:#35AADC;}
.btn-primary{background:#35AADC;}
.popup-menu .btn-popupmenu{background: #fff;color: #666;padding:0 20px 0 8px;}
.popup{border-bottom:3px #35AADC solid;}
.popup-inner a{color: #666;}
.popup-inner a:hover{color: #35AADC;}
.popup-user-menu li.log-out a{color: #35AADC;}
.popup-inner h4 a:hover{color:#35AADC;}
.slider .owl-controls .owl-page span{background:#35AADC;}
.slider .owl-controls .owl-buttons div{background:#35AADC;}
.slider-one .post-title{background:#333D46;opacity:0.7;}
.slider-two .post-title{background:#333D46;opacity:0.7;}
.slider-three .post-title{background:#333D46;opacity:0.7;}
#top-carousel .post-title{background:#333D46;opacity:0.7;}
#top-carousel.slider-one .post-title{background:#333D46;opacity:0.7;}
#footer{background:#35AADC;}
#nav-footer.nav-container{background:#35AADC;}
@media only screen and (min-width:720px){
    #nav-footer .nav ul li{border-bottom:1px solid #333D46;}
}
.post-hover:hover .post-title a{color:#35AADC;}
.post-title a:hover{color:#35AADC;}
.post-title i.fa-thumb-tack{color: #35AADC;}
.big-thumb .post-tag a:hover{color:#35AADC;}
.box-title{background:#35AADC;}
.box-title a{color: #444;}
.post-box.pic-posts .medium-thumb .post-title{background:#333D46;opacity:0.7;}
.page-nav span.current,
.page-nav a:hover{background:#35AADC;}
.post-tags a:hover{background-color:#35AADC;}
.widget a:hover{color:#35AADC;}
.widget .widget-title{background:#35AADC;}
.widget ul li:hover a{color:#35AADC;}
.widget-thumb:hover .post-title{color:#35AADC;}
.widget-recent-comments ul span.comment-author{color:#35AADC;}
.widget-recent-comments ul a:hover{color:#35AADC;}
.social-icons-widget input[type="submit"]{background:#35AADC;}
.widget_calendar a:hover{color:#35AADC;}
.widget_calendar caption{background:#35AADC;}
.comment-tabs li.active a{color:#35AADC;border-bottom-color:#35AADC;}
.comment-awaiting-moderation{color:#35AADC;}
.tag-sort #first-letter a{background:#35AADC;}
.post-pages span{background:#35AADC;border: 1px solid #35AADC;color:#fff;}
#user-menu li.current-post-ancestor,
#user-menu li.current-menu-ancestor,
#user-menu li.current-menu-parent,
#user-menu li.current-menu-item{margin:-1px;border-top:1px solid #eee; border-bottom: 1px solid #eee; border-left:5px solid #35AADC;background:#fff;}
#user-menu li.current-post-ancestor a,
#user-menu li.current-menu-ancestor a,
#user-menu li.current-menu-parent a,
#user-menu li.current-menu-item a{margin-left:-5px;color:#35AADC;}
.new-title-style .box-title span,
.new-title-style .sidebar .widget > .widget-title span{border-bottom: 2px solid #35AADC;}
.resp-tabs-list li.resp-tab-active {background-color: #35AADC;}

#footer-widgets .social-icons-widget input[type="submit"]{background:#35AADC;}
#field-wrapper .send-button{
    background:#35AADC;
}
#fep-content .fep-pagination>.active>a,
#fep-content .fep-pagination>.active>span, 
#fep-content .fep-pagination>.active>a:hover, 
#fep-content .fep-pagination>.active>span:hover,
#fep-content .fep-pagination>.active>a:focus,
#fep-content .fep-pagination>.active>span:focus {
    background-color: #35AADC;
}
#fep-content .fep-pagination>li>a:hover,
#fep-content .fep-pagination>li>span:hover,
#fep-content .fep-pagination>li>a:focus,
#fep-content .fep-pagination>li>span:focus {
    background-color: #35AADC;
}
.front-end-pm-form .fep-button {
    background: #35AADC;
}
.cmpuser-form input[type="submit"],
.cmpuser-save input[type="submit"] {
    background: #35AADC;
    border-color: #35AADC;
}
.entry .dwqa-container a{color:#666;}
.entry .dwqa-ask-question a,
.entry .my-dwqa-ask-question a{color:#fff;background:#35AADC;border: 1px solid #35AADC;}
.entry .my-dwqa-ask-question a:hover{background:#666;border: 1px solid #666;}
.dwqa-pagination span.dwqa-current, .dwqa-pagination a:hover {
    background: #35AADC;
    color: #fff;
}
.dwqa-pagination a, .dwqa-pagination span {
    background: #fff;
    color: #999;
}
.dwqa-content-edit-form input[type="submit"],
.dwqa-ask-question a,
.dwqa-btn-primary{
    border:1px solid #35AADC;
    background:#35AADC;
}

/*color 3*/
.side-buttons .side-buttons-box{background:#333D46;}
h2.resp-tab-active{background:#333D46;}
.search-expand{background:#333D46;}
#nav-header.nav-container{background:#333D46;}
.btn{background:#333D46;}
.btn-primary:hover{background:#35AADC;}
@media only screen and (min-width:720px){
    #nav-header .nav ul{background:#333D46 url(../img/opacity-10.png) repeat;}
    #nav-footer .nav ul{background:#333D46;}
}
@media only screen and (max-width:719px){
    #nav-topbar .nav{background: #333D46;}
    #nav-topbar .nav li a{color:#eee;}
    #nav-footer .nav li a{color:#eee;border-top:1px solid #ddd;}
    .toggle-search{width:20px;right:auto;left:0;top:0;-webkit-box-shadow:1px 0 0 rgba(255,255,255,0.1);box-shadow:1px 0 0 rgba(255,255,255,0.1);}
    .search-expand{left:0;right:auto;top:50px;/*width:320px;*/}
}

#breadcrumb a:hover,
.post-box article:hover .post-title a,
.post-list article:hover .post-title a{color:#35AADC;}
.post-box article:hover .more-link,
.post-list article:hover .more-link{background:#35AADC;color:#fff;}
.commentlist .comment-body:hover .reply{background:#35AADC;}